Bantry Bay and the Atlantic Seaboard Hotel Tier

Cape Town's hotel market divides more sharply than most African cities between boutique properties with fewer than 30 rooms and large-format hotels that absorb group travel, families, and longer stays at scale. Bantry Bay sits between the high-density hotel strip of Sea Point and the quieter residential pocket of Fresnaye, giving addresses here a coastal character without the full commercial noise of the V&A Waterfront precinct. The President Hotel, at 349 rooms, operates firmly within the large-format category — a scale that positions it in a different competitive set from design-led properties like 21 Nettleton or Camissa House, and closer in scope to the kind of property where coastal access and family infrastructure matter more than architectural restraint.

The Atlantic Seaboard's hotel corridor has seen increasing pressure from the upper end of the boutique market, with properties like Cape Royale Luxury Suites and Cape Cadogan Boutique Hotel drawing guests who want something smaller and more curated. Against that context, the President holds ground through category recognition: its dual award status — Regional Winner for Luxury Family Hotel and Continent Winner for Luxury Coastal Hotel , signals a specific positioning that prioritises coastal orientation and family-appropriate scale over the boutique intimacy that defines the other end of this market.

Scale, Atmosphere, and the Atlantic Approach

Approaching from Alexander Road, Bantry Bay's residential scale gives way to the building's coastal presence. A 349-room property on the Atlantic Seaboard occupies a physical footprint that announces itself differently from the hillside discretion of properties like Mount Nelson or the enclosed garden character of Mount Nelson, A Belmond Hotel. The Atlantic facing position means that the practical rhythm of a stay here is organized around ocean light and the particular wind patterns that Cape Town's Seaboard guests either learn to read or simply accept. The southeaster, which builds through November and peaks in February, changes how outdoor spaces function and how far in advance you want to plan sea-facing activities.

That seasonal variable is worth factoring into timing. Arriving outside the peak summer window , broadly March through May or September through October , means calmer conditions, lower pressure on availability, and a city that has exhaled slightly after the December and January influx. Planning a Stay: Practical Orientation

The hotel's address at 4 Alexander Road places it in Bantry Bay, accessible from Cape Town's city centre in under 15 minutes by car outside peak traffic. The V&A Waterfront and the city bowl are similarly close, making the location practical for guests who want coastal sleep with easy access to the dining, retail, and cultural infrastructure of central Cape Town.
